Output d843a3d56e74d4d01d55c23e753e85320bd0f8fdde6d84f541e206108285a24e:27

value
33275784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ea0ae7cdb8ef5bb5cbf46282c0aaf0c6f5c127cd OP_EQUAL
address
3P2X7A8nNhvcaq533y5KqQT2H1XLm4raFt
transaction
d843a3d56e74d4d01d55c23e753e85320bd0f8fdde6d84f541e206108285a24e
spent
true